Read moreFrank Holten State Park is a glorious, expansive park nestled on the edge of East St. Louis and easily accessible to the greater St. Louis Metro East community. There are several native habitats to explore and admire with some amazing plants and trees. It is home to diverse wildlife. It's a great place for walking, playing, relaxing, exploring, and more. It's a great space for photographers. There is a large lake and fishing is permitted.
